Here I am on a Wi-Fi equipped plane flying over the Pacific on a business trip to China and I'm able to check where my i8 is spending the night (on a ship moored in Southampton, England for the moment) since the ship it's on is tracked on a web site via GPS data.
Carac, since you indicated your ship is just about out of range for the Marine Traffic tracking, have you tried the Sailwx web site? This appears to cover the globe and uses weather reports that the ships provide, along with their GPS coordinates, to track their positions. I was able to locate my ship, Boheme, on both Sailwx as well as Marine Traffic. Takes 3ish days to get to the port then it needs to be there 2-4 days before the boat to make it on the manifest, depending on how many are waiting in front of you.
